Lower Rongbu is a village situated in Kharkutta block of East Garo Hills district in Meghalaya.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 129 families residing in the village Lower Rongbu. The total population of Lower Rongbu is 704 out of which 362 are males and 342 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Lower Rongbu is 945.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Lower Rongbu village is 127 which is 18% of the total population. There are 67 male children and 60 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Lower Rongbu is 896 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(945) of Lower Rongbu village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Lower Rongbu is 76.6%. Thus Lower Rongbu village has a higher literacy rate compared to 60.4% of East Garo Hills district. The male literacy rate is 79.32% and the female literacy rate is 73.76% in Lower Rongbu village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 98% of total population in Lower Rongbu village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Lower Rongbu village out of total population, 315 were engaged in work activities. 58.7%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 41.3%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 315 workers engaged in Main Work, 41 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 88 were Agricultural labourers.
